The hydrothermal synthesis Of V2O5, Ag2O and H2L (H2L = pyridine-2,6-dicarboxylic acid) in water at 180 degreesC for 72 It yields a novel 2D coordination polymer [VAgLO2](n) (1). Each V center chelates to a tridentate ligand L, while the tetrahedral conformation of Ag center consists of four O atoms. V and Ag polyhedra alternate by either carboxyl or oxo bridges to further form a unique 3d-4d heterometal-based 2D grid motif.
